Abstract
Punica granatum is a naturalized species in Mexico, and the actual variability is the result of informal processes of continuous introduction, sexual propagation, selective propagation and only recently, intentional hybridization and selection.
Recent imports pushed development of property cultivars with traits competitive to the international standard cultivars Wonderful and Mollar, but maintaining valuable traits such as summer bearing and high productivity.
High content of interesting phytochemicals with antioxidant properties is also a paramount breeding goal.
In this paper we describe four improved cultivars obtained at the Instituto Nacional de Investigaciones Forestales Agricolas y Pecuarias (INIFAP) suitable for cultivation in central semiarid Mexico.
The cultivar 37-5 presented outstanding content of punicalagin, a compound highly valuable for nutriceutical applications.
The cultivar 37-12 presented higher juice yield than Wonderful, lower acidity, and was richer in bioactive compounds.
The vitamin C content of the juice of cultivars 37-5, 36-11 and 37-12 also surpassed Wonderful, properties that in turn are associated to superior antioxidant activity.
